Output 580771225d7516f67cb5d3d76008662c5dc8dce76329814739024605337131bd:4

value
183556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57a87632eace041f161eeb5452854efb64ad6774 OP_EQUAL
address
39gWXA8Aqhh8ePkuoyYPNamLCJXHDsWuBm
transaction
580771225d7516f67cb5d3d76008662c5dc8dce76329814739024605337131bd
spent
true